WebMar 19, 2024 · 6. Fostering Dogs: As a result of Van Dusen v. Commissioner , animal rescuers nationwide that are fostering dogs and/or cats for approved charities may claim the expenses during tax time. An approved charity is one that is recognized by the IRS with the 501 (c) (3) designation as a Not-for-Profit organization.
